Hi Maria,

No this should work. Our Maven build even didn’t notified such errors. Did
you build whole framework ?

On Fri, 19 May 2023 at 09:37, Maria Jose Esteve <mjest...@iest.com> wrote:

> Hi, good morning.
> I have compiled the SDK and got errors with the latest changes.
> Specifically the changes in TileHorizontalLayout are giving errors.
> @Piotr, is this half done?
>
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ileHorizontalLayout.as(49):
> col: 15 Error: interface method willTrigger in interface IEventDispatcher
> not implemented by class TileHorizontalLayout
>      [java]
>      [java]                public class TileHorizontalLayout extends
> SimpleHorizontalLayout implements IEventDispatcher
>      [java]                             ^
>      [java]
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ileHorizontalLayout.as(141):
> col: 28 Error: Incompatible override.
>      [java]
>      [java]                                override public function
> beadsAddedHandler(event:Event = null):void
>      [java]                                                         ^
>      [java]
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ileHorizontalLayout.as(141):
> col: 52 Error: Ambiguous reference to Event
>      [java]
>      [java]                                override public function
> beadsAddedHandler(event:Event = null):void
>      [java]
>                  ^
>      [java]
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ileHorizontalLayout.as(141):
> col: 60 Warning: Incompatible initializer value of type 'Null' where '' is
> expected. " +        "An initial value of null will be used instead.
>      [java]
>      [java]                                override public function
> beadsAddedHandler(event:Event = null):void
>      [java]
>                          ^
>      [java]
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ileHorizontalLayout.as(146):
> col: 36 Error: Ambiguous reference to Event
>      [java]
>      [java]
> hostComponent.dispatchEvent(new Event("layoutNeeded"));
>      [java]
>                 ^
>      [java]
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ileHorizontalLayout.as(351):
> col: 45 Error: Ambiguous reference to Event
>      [java]
>      [java]                                private function
> observedChangeSize(event:Event):void
>      [java]
>           ^
>      [java]
>      [java]
> D:\Develop_Royale\Projects\Royale-SDK\royale-asjs\frameworks\projects\Jewel\src\main\royale\org\apache\royale\jewel\beads\layouts\TileVerticalLayout.as(52):
> col: 15 Error: interface method willTrigger in interface IEventDispatcher
> not implemented by class TileVerticalLayout
>      [java]
>      [java]                public class TileVerticalLayout extends
> SimpleVerticalLayout implements IEventDispatcher
>
> Hiedra
>
> --

Piotr Zarzycki

Reply via email to